About The Position

The Resort Services Agent (RS Agent) combines the skills of a Guest Services, Retail Clerk, and Rental Tech Agent to create a versatile team member. This role is dynamic, involving sales, high customer service standards, and requires the agent to become a subject matter expert (with training provided). The RS Agent will contribute to a safe guest experience and support daily operations across various outlets. As the primary frontline contact with guests, the agent must engage them positively and professionally represent the resort. This position demands the ability to handle a high volume of guests and requires flexibility to transition quickly and effectively between different tasks and operating outlets. The RS Agent is expected to be knowledgeable about all resort offerings and activities, providing accurate information, engaging guests, and proactively selling the right products and services. The core of this role involves providing accurate information, being animated, and proactively selling.
